February Meeting  Wednesday, February 1st, 2017, 7:00 PM  

At our February meeting we will be judging the annual Wisconsin PSA Club Showcase.  Fifteen camera clubs from across Wisconsin have submitted images to the Showcase this year, so you will a lot of great images.  All participating clubs are now in the process of judging the images with final results being available in May.  Our club has done well over the years, most often ranking in the top five.  Please bring a pen, something hard to write on and a small flashlight to help you see your scoring sheet.

Following the judging we use some of the images to start a discussion on what makes a good image.  We will also have some time to critique member images.

Photo Scavenger Hunt:

Our Photo Scavenger Hunt has become a popular annual event which we will be doing again this year.  Photo scavenger hunts are a fun and challenging way to get your imagination and creative juices flowing! The rules are simple: 
1. Capture one image of each topic. 
2. Be creative - think of a unique way to express the topic.   
3. Images should be taken in 2017. 
Your scavenger hunt images will be shown at our Holiday Party in December.  
The topics for our 2017 Scavenger Hunt are: 
1. Fun
2. Patina
3. Detail
4. Liquid
5. Dew
6. Fungi
7. Feather
8. Creature
9. Motion
10. Soft

Ian Plant – The Wide Angle Landscape – Saturday, March 4th.  Ian Plant is a world-renowned professional photographer and frequent contributor to leading photography magazines.  His program will look at the use of wide angle lenses to create some compelling and unique landscape images.  This seminar is sponsored by WACCO as part of their continuing efforts to bring quality programs to us at a reasonable cost.  Fee for the program and lunch is $45 if you register before February  5th, $65 after February 5th.  For more information see the WACCO website:  www.wicameraclubs.org .

Southwest Michigan Camera Club Council (SWMCCC) Summer Weekend of Photography and Digital Imaging, July 28-30, 2017:  This annual event features three days of workshops on many aspects of photography and digital imaging.  Fieldtrips include Birds of Prey and night shoots.  For more information go to www.SWMCCC.org
